#4.3 RM AI Tools - Elicit

 

What is Elicit?

Elicit is an AI-powered research assistant designed to help scholars quickly find, summarize, and analyze academic papers. It automates literature reviews by extracting key information from papers, such as abstracts, methodologies, and conclusions, without requiring full-text access.


Hands-on Guide for Research Scholars

Step 1: Getting Started

  1. Visit Elicit and sign up (optional for saving queries).
  2. Enter a Research Question in the search bar (e.g., "What are the effects of climate change on agriculture?").

Step 2: Reviewing Search Results

  • Elicit automatically retrieves relevant academic papers from sources like Semantic Scholar.
  • It extracts key information such as:
    • Title & Abstract (quick overview of the paper).
    • Study Type & Sample Size (helpful for evaluating research rigor).
    • Findings & Conclusions (key insights without reading full papers).

Step 3: Filtering & Refining Results

  • Use filters to refine papers based on study type, publication year, or methodology.
  • Click on a paper to view more details, including citations and links to full text.

Step 4: Comparing Papers & Extracting Insights

  • Elicit allows side-by-side comparison of multiple papers to identify trends and gaps.
  • Use the "Summarize" feature to generate a concise overview of research findings.

Step 5: Exporting & Organizing Research

  • Download selected papers and summaries for offline review.
  • Export citation data for reference management tools like Zotero or Mendeley.
  • Save queries to revisit updated results over time.
